Post subject:  Fiskerton Fen Scrapes

Was awake early to see if our bunting had blown down (it hadn't) so got down to Fiskerton for just after 7am. Beautiful morning.
Jackdaw x1
Starling x30
Magpie x1
Reed Bunting x1
Bl Hd Gull x3
Shelduck x2
Common Tern x1
Lapwing x4
Lt Egret x1

Found it difficult to count the following 3 as they were all over the place, swooping in and out of view
Hse Martin
Swallow
Swift

Mute Swan x2
Mallard x8
Shoveler x2
Greylag x10 plus 12 young
Canada x4 plus 5 young
Tufted duck x3
Redshank x2 plus 2 young (the log book stated 3 earlier in the week)
Tree Sparrow x1 (sat on a twig right in front of the hide, fantastic)
Barn Owl x1
